My fascination with meteorites, shooting stars and Space came about at an early age. As a kid, I used to get up early to watch the spectacle of meteor showers from my back yard. In college, I studied history, while history was being made, with the Apollo Lunar Missions. As I grew older, I would get to drag my kids out of bed, to watch the Perseids, Geminids and other meteor showers with me. A born collector, I assembled a very small collection of meteorites, always fascinated by their history.

Living in the Washington, D.C. area has given me invaluable opportunities to attend many Space related lectures, symposiums, conferences as well as the National Air and Space Museum. Being able to talk and listen to, astronauts, scientists and astronomers has given me a much deeper appreciation and understanding of Space.

As a pen craftsman, I have searched for a way to incorporate my love for Space and my desire to make high quality, unique pens. The result is shown on these pages. Hopefully I have succeeded.

Each pen that you order is made by me personally, in my shop. Hours are spent on each one, from casting the resin to final assembly, to assure that the quality is consistent throughout.
